Proper lighting design and installation in Shingle Springs require both technical expertise and a deep understanding of local regulations and challenges. Nestled in the Sierra foothills, Shingle Springs features a mix of historic homes, modern builds, and rural properties, each with unique lighting needs. Older homes in the area often have outdated wiring systems that may require upgrades to safely accommodate LED fixtures or energy-efficient lighting. Additionally, limited attic access and strict HOA guidelines for exterior lighting can add complexity to installation projects. For newer builds, Title 24 compliance—a California energy code—mandates the use of high-efficiency lighting, motion sensors, and dimmers to reduce energy consumption.
Outdoor lighting in Shingle Springs must also align with regional dark-sky compliance rules to minimize light pollution, particularly in rural and semi-rural neighborhoods. Homeowners in wildfire-prone zones often prioritize exterior fixtures designed to meet safety codes, such as fire-rated can housings and corrosion-resistant materials. Local permitting and inspections are overseen by the El Dorado County Building Services Division, which ensures lighting projects meet all electrical and safety standards. Depending on the scope of work, homeowners can expect to spend $200–$400 per recessed light fixture or $2,000–$10,000 for a comprehensive home lighting upgrade.
Whether you’re modernizing a mid-century ranch in Cameron Park or customizing a luxury estate in Greenstone, professional lighting installation in Shingle Springs demands careful planning, adherence to code requirements, and an eye for functional design that enhances your property’s value and ambiance.

Yes, in most cases, a licensed electrician is required for lighting installations. Electrical work involves safety risks, and improper installation can cause electrical fires, shock, or code violations. A licensed professional ensures the installation is compliant with National Electrical Code (NEC) and local regulations. Always verify the electrician’s license by checking with your state’s licensing board or an official authority like the National Electrical Contractors Association before hiring.
